Steps to reproduce:
- Navigate from Second Fragment to Child nav graph (with non-nullable parameters).
- Navigate to Third fragment using SafeArgs and the app crashes.
Crash log:
Process: cz.dels.issues, PID: 1743
java.lang.NullPointerException: null cannot be cast to non-null type kotlin.Long

Description
NavType should not require extended classes to override the
name
property. Name is used exclusively internal forNavInflater
for classes that are inflated from XML. All the types that need to implementname
already do, and custom NavTypes should not have this requirement.Instead of being abstract, the
name
property should default to another string (i.e. "nav_type").
